What Happens After AGI? The Future of Work


Listen Later

In today's episode of the Daily AI Show, Brian, Beth, Andy, Eran, Karl, and Jyunmi discussed the intriguing and complex topic of what happens after Artificial General Intelligence (AGI) is achieved. The conversation explored the potential societal impacts, the redefinition and future of work and purpose, and the possible future scenarios we might face.

Key Points Discussed:

  • Definition and Implications of AGI and ASI:

    AGI refers to AI systems capable of performing any intellectual task that a human can, while ASI (Artificial Superintelligence) would surpass human intelligence. The potential arrival of AGI could transform industries by making many human jobs redundant, leading to significant societal shifts.

  • Economic and Social Dynamics:

    The panel debated the role of universal basic income (UBI) as a possible solution to job displacement caused by AGI. They discussed how the shift might open up opportunities for entrepreneurship and other non-traditional forms of work.

  • Impact on Various Job Sectors:

    AI's effect on white-collar jobs is expected to be more immediate and profound, especially in roles like marketing, customer service, and knowledge work. Blue-collar jobs, such as those in the fast-food industry and firefighting, might also see automation, although the capital investment required could delay these changes.

  • Personal Reflections and Future Outlook:

    The conversation touched on personal stories and reflections about how job roles define personal identity and purpose. The psychological and emotional aspects of such a transformation were highlighted, with concerns about mental health and societal well-being.

  • Technological Evolution and Education:

    The need for education systems to adapt to the new reality where AI can teach complex subjects was emphasized. The importance of fostering AI literacy and preparing society for the inevitable changes was discussed.

  • Broader Philosophical Implications:

    The discussion ventured into philosophical territory, questioning the very nature of human purpose and meaning in a world where work as we know it might drastically change. The potential for a more creative and fulfilling society was considered, akin to the shifts seen during the agricultural revolution.
